A Tale of Two Farmers
In the Midwest, the proliferation of AI-driven tools such as autonomous tractors and precision farming drones suggests a golden age for large-scale agribusiness. These technological advances can lead to increased yields and reduced labor costs. In 2026, agribusinesses that embraced AI saw crop yields increase by nearly 15% compared to their counterparts who hesitated, according to research from relevant agricultural extensions. However, these gains come against a backdrop of persistent inflation—measured at 3.3%, squeezing margins—and a labor market where unemployment in rural areas hovers at 4.3%, leaving many small farmers struggling to adapt against the rising tide of automation.
The divergence is stark: while operations with robust capital can harness AI for predictive analytics, improving their input efficiency, smallholder farms often lack the resources to invest in these innovations. Contextually, the interest rate, sitting at 3.64%, poses additional challenges; financing such technological upgrades becomes burdensome for smaller operations that already operate on thin margins.
The Hidden Farmhand Crisis
At the heart of the agricultural AI conversation is an overlooked yet critical issue: the displacement of the farm labor force. As mechanization sweeps through fields, the traditional farmhand begins to vanish from the landscape, replaced by lines of code and machine learning algorithms. Large agribusinesses celebrate the increased efficiency that AI brings, yet the social ramifications run deeper. Communities centered around farming face an existential crisis as fewer jobs become available, exacerbating the rural unemployment figures. What headlines glowingly report as productivity gains mask the realities of communities whose livelihoods hang in balance. The displacement gathers pace when juxtaposed against global competitors like Brazil, where labor remains cheaper, and automation isn’t as widespread. Investment in labor-saving technologies might not yield the same returns in regions where people are still affordable and available.
